I got this guitar for the 'built in' piezo pickup...and the acoustic abilities. I would get another one like mine...if it were lost or stolen. I really like the charcoal grey color.
Sound
It has a very nice 'strat' sound, and with the piezo...the acoustic sound is also quite good. The humbucker pickups give a deeper tone than a straight strat.
Features
The stereo output cable is nice. One split is the pickups, the other is the piezo...so you can amp them seperately...if you want. The 13 pin plug also carries the pickups (not the acoustic)...as part of the connection
Quality
Great finish. I put a little scratch on the back of it though...so now it is 'broken in' The neck plays well....something between a strat and a Gibson feel. I play out every week, and feel comfortable with the dependability.
Value
Quite happy with it...this is my first 'made in China' guitar, and they do great work.
Manufacturer Support
I got a quick response, and good information from their support staff. I added some Flatwound strings (11-50's)...and needed to re-adjust the tremolo arm springs. I got good advice on the 'how to'...to do it correctly.
The Wow Factor
It can do a wide range of tones, and with the Gr-20, is a very versitile instrument.
